# ipscan
> A fast network scanner designed to be simple to use.
> Also known as Angry IP Scanner.
> More information: <https://angryip.org/>.
- Scan a specific IP address:
`ipscan {{192.168.0.1}}`
- Scan a range of IP addresses:
`ipscan {{192.168.0.1-254}}`
- Scan a range of IP addresses and save the results to a file:
`ipscan {{192.168.0.1-254}} -o {{path/to/output.txt}}`
- Scan IPs with a specific set of ports:
`ipscan {{192.168.0.1-254}} -p {{80,443,22}}`
- Scan with a delay between requests to avoid network congestion:
`ipscan {{192.168.0.1-254}} -d {{200}}`
- Display help:
`ipscan --help`

# pacgraph
> Draw a graph of installed packages to PNG/SVG/GUI/console.
> More information: <https://github.com/keenerd/pacgraph>.
- Produce an SVG and PNG graph:
`pacgraph`
- Produce an SVG graph:
`pacgraph --svg`
- Print summary to console:
`pacgraph --console`
- Override the default filename/location (Note: Do not specify the file extension):
`pacgraph --file={{path/to/file}}`
- Change the color of packages that are not dependencies:
`pacgraph --top={{color}}`
- Change the color of package dependencies:
`pacgraph --dep={{color}}`
- Change the background color of a graph:
`pacgraph --background={{color}}`
- Change the color of links between packages:
`pacgraph --link={{color}}`
